O le ultrafine titanium boride paʻu ua saunia e se fesuiaiga o loʻo iai nei leisa ion beam kasa metotia faʻamama maualuga, laʻititi laʻititi lapopoʻa, tufatufa toniga, tele vaega faʻapitoa i luga o le fogaeleele ma le maualuga o le gaioiga. O le ultrafine titanium boride ceramic powder o se paʻu efuefu-uliuli. O vaega o le paʻu o loʻo i ai se fausaga tioata atoa hexagonal. O lona fuala'au vaila'au o le TiB2, mole mamafa 69.52, density 4.52 g/cm3, liusuavai 2980 ° C, microhardness 34 Gpa, conductivity vevela 25 J/msk, fa'aluma fa'alautele fa'atasi 8.1×10-6 m/mk, resistivity 14.4 μΩ·cm . Titanium diboride efuefu gaosia e Yinuo Material e maualuga le liusuavai, maualuga le maaa, abrasion teteʻe, acid ma alkali tetee, conductivity lelei eletise, conductivity vevela malosi, mautu sili kemikolo ma teteʻi teʻi vevela, ma maualuga oxidation tetee vevela. E mafai ona tetee i le faʻamaʻiina i lalo ole 1100 °C, ma o ana oloa e maualuga le malosi ma le faigata.
O se tasi o mea mata'utia o vacuum-coated conductive evaporation vaa, mea keramika tu'ufa'atasi. E mafai ona faʻaaogaina e avea o se vaega taua o mea faʻapipiʻi faʻapipiʻi tele, ma e aofia ai TiC, TiN, SiC ma isi mea e fai ai vaega eseese o le vevela maualuga ma vaega faʻatino, e pei o le vevela vevela ma vaega afi. O se tasi foi o mea e sili ona lelei mo le faia o mea e puipuia ai le ofutau, mea faigaluega tipi sima ma limu. O mea faigaluega fa'auma, uaea ata ua mate, extrusion mate, oneone fa'asu'u nozzles, fa'amaufa'ailoga vaega, ma isi mea e mafai ona gaosia. Aluminium electrolytic cell cathode mea e ufiufi ai. Ona o le susu lelei o le TiB2 ma le uʻamea alumini fofo, e mafai ona faʻaaogaina le TiB2 e fai ma mea faʻapipiʻi cathode o le alumini electrolytic cell, lea e mafai ona faʻaitiitia ai le faʻaogaina o le eletise eletise alumini ma faʻaumiumi le ola o le cell electrolytic. E faia i le PTC fa'amafanafana mea sima ma fetuutuunai mea PTC. E saogalemu, faʻasaoina le malosi, faʻatuatuaina, faigofie ona faʻaogaina ma faʻapipiʻi. O se mea fou fa'atekonolosi fou o ituaiga eseese o mea fa'avevela eletise. Conductive mea keramika.
